centos7 安装postgresql-9.5

来源:互联网 发布:人民大学数据库 编辑:程序博客网 时间:2024/05/16 17:15

1、下载、安装

   yum localinstall http://yum.postgresql.org/9.5/redhat/rhel-7-x86_64/pgdg-centos95-9.5-2.noarch.rpmyum install -y postgresql95-server.x86_64 postgresql95-contrib.x86_64 postgresql95-libs.x86_64 

2 、初始化数据库

/usr/pgsql-9.5/bin/postgresql95-setup initdb

3、配置远程连接

vi /var/lib/pgsql/9.5/data/postgresql.conf 

修改#listen_addresses = ‘localhost’ 为 listen_addresses=’*’
当然,此处‘*’也可以改为任何你想开放的服务器IP

信任远程连接

   vi /var/lib/pgsql/9.5/data/pg_hba.conf

修改如下内容,信任指定服务器连接
# IPv4 local connections:
host all all 127.0.0.1/32 trust
host all all 10.211.55.6/32(需要连接的服务器IP) trust
当然这个IP可以为一个ip范围如:10.211.55.0/24
另外需要开启防火墙相应端口,默认为5432

4、启动

设置pg开机启动

systemctl enable postgresql-9.5.service

启动pg服务

 systemctl start postgresql-9.5.service 

5、一些简单操作
连接数据库

su - postgrespsql

创建数据库、用户

su - postgrespsqlCREATE USER xxxx1 WITH PASSWORD 'xxxx';CREATE DATABASE xxxx2;GRANT ALL PRIVILEGES ON DATABASE xxxx2 to xxxx1;//修改密码 alter user postgres with password 'foobar';//显示数据库 \l //退出 \q
0 0
原创粉丝点击